Some concerning titles and themes, but generally mild animated content.
Titles like "SUCK ME!" and "EXPLODING SNOWPLOW" are concerning, even if the content itself is likely benign. The video "TANK! - Will it Attack?" also suggests potentially aggressive themes, though the animation style might mitigate this for young viewers. The channel's attempt to manipulate the safety analysis process by including 'NOT A.İ' in a title is a red flag regarding trustworthiness.
No Shorts content, focusing entirely on longer-form videos.
This channel exclusively uploads long-form videos, with 100% of its recent uploads being longer than one minute. This approach does not contribute to addictive scrolling behavior often associated with short-form content.
Targets preschoolers with simple car animations, but some titles are ambiguous.
The content, featuring cartoon cars and simple scenarios, appears aimed at preschoolers. However, titles such as "Whoopee! - Cartoons for Kids" and "Playground HOOLIGAN!" lack specific age guidance, and some titles could be misinterpreted by parents.
Primarily entertainment with minimal explicit educational objectives.
The videos are largely entertainment-focused, depicting cartoon cars in various scenarios like "Breakfast JAM!" or "Road Repairs". While some videos might implicitly touch on concepts like helping or problem-solving, there are no clear educational objectives or learning outcomes presented.
PloopChannel features animated videos primarily about cartoon cars engaging in simple adventures and daily activities. The content is designed for young children, focusing on visual storytelling rather than dialogue or explicit educational lessons.
Parents should be aware that while the animation style is generally gentle, some video titles use suggestive or mildly aggressive language that might not align with content they want for very young children. The channel also attempted to manipulate the safety analysis process, which is a significant concern for trustworthiness.
